During the 19th and early 20th centuries, the British established tea and coffee plantations across this region, and Ella became a vital hub for their administration and leisure. The architecture reflects this era, with distinct styles blending European influences with tropical adaptations. Think sturdy stone buildings, elegant verandas, steep roofs designed to withstand monsoon rains, and the enduring presence of the Ceylon Railway system, a monumental feat of engineering that opened up the hill country. Q:What kind of colonial architecture can I expect to see in Ella?

A: You can expect to see buildings influenced by British colonial styles, often adapted for the tropical climate. This includes structures with wide verandas, steep roofs, stone foundations, and sometimes elements of Victorian and Edwardian design, particularly in older bungalows and administrative buildings. The Ella Railway Station is a prime example of this era's functional yet elegant engineering.

Best Time to Visit

Weather

Ella enjoys a pleasant, cool climate year-round due to its high altitude, though it experiences distinct wet and dry spells. Expect misty mornings, occasional showers, and comfortably warm days with cooler evenings. The surrounding mountains often contribute to cloud cover and humidity.

Best Months

The dry season from December to April generally offers the sunniest weather, making it ideal for trekking and enjoying the views. September and October can also be good, with slightly fewer crowds than the peak December-January period.

Peak Season

The peak season typically runs from December to February, coinciding with the driest weather and the Christmas/New Year holidays. Expect larger crowds, higher accommodation prices, and a lively atmosphere.

Off Season

The monsoon season, primarily from May to August and then again from October to November, sees more rain. However, this also means fewer tourists, lower prices, and lush, vibrant green landscapes.

Transportation Tips

Getting around Ella is quite straightforward. For local exploration, tuk-tuks are readily available and offer a convenient way to reach attractions like the Nine Arch Bridge or Little Adam's Peak, with prices negotiable. Walking is also a fantastic option for shorter distances and to soak in the atmosphere, especially around town. For longer day trips or to reach slightly more remote spots, hiring a car with a driver provides comfort and flexibility. The famous scenic train journey is an attraction in itself, connecting Ella to other hill country towns.
